tipen 1. way of; manner of; seem 2. see tipe- 3. piece of |

1. | Āinwōt baj tipen ḷaddik abōblep men ṇe | That boy looks like the stubborn type. | abōblep |
2. | Ebarāinwōt tipen kōiie i loṃaḷo meñe ej jañin kar tar meto kaṇ rōḷḷap. | It seemed seaworthy in the lagoon, but it had not yet traveled on the high sea. P15 | kōiie |
3. | Ebarāinwōt tipen kōiie i loṃaḷo meñe ej jañin kar tar meto kaṇ rōḷḷap. | It seemed seaworthy in the lagoon, but it had not yet traveled on the high sea. P15 | meñe |
4. | Einwōt baj tipen addikọọtotin ri-Ṃajeḷ. | It looks like an index finger belonging to a Marshallese. | addi-kọọtot |
5. | Einwōt baj tipen ri-kaakōr men raṇ. | They look like they're the type who catch mullet. | akōr |
6. | Einwōt kwobaj tipen pikōt | You seem scared. | tipen |
7. | Kōkāāle kōketaak (ekketaak) jab ṇe bwe tipen ṃor | Fix that one attachment as it seems old. | kōketaak |
8. | Tipen ri-ajejin Jowa men raṇe. | They're the sort who ask to have gifts returned. | ajejin Jowa |
9. | Tipen rūttōbok | He has the look of a man who knows how to fish the ettōbok method. | ettōbok |
10. | Tipen wōjke | Piece cut from a tree. | tipen |
